What you describe ("the temprature controller shall override the pressure controller") is not truly Cascade control, if you really mean Override. In cascade the temperature controller would be continuously sending a a set point to the pressure controller- override being an on/off term imho.
But assuming you do mean continuous Cascade:
You say "temperature control as the master to the pressure control", which correctly for cascade would work if the temperature moves slower than the pressure.
However you also say "My objective is to achieve the process gas dew point"
That suggest to me humidity control. Do measure humidity itself?
